SpaceX, founded in 2002 by Elon Musk, has transformed the aerospace sector with reusable rockets like the Falcon 9 and the ambitious Starship program. The company’s engineering teams pioneer propulsion chemistry, advanced avionics, and software that enable rapid, cost‑effective launches, while its Starlink satellite network pushes global broadband into new territories.
SpaceX hires across a spectrum of disciplines: aerospace, electrical, mechanical, and software engineering; manufacturing, quality assurance, and supply‑chain logistics; data science, cybersecurity, and AI; plus business functions such as finance, legal, marketing, and human resources. Candidates can expect a rigorous, multi‑step interview process that tests technical depth, problem‑solving speed, and cultural fit in a high‑velocity environment.
